IP查询
查询
你查询的IP:[120.137.31.46] 地理位置:中国–上海–上海佰隆网络
最新查询
118.132.230.129
117.60.242.75
60.160.167.23
218.109.197.8
123.242.45.22
124.128.60.98
59.155.228.81
124.192.176.200
114.68.15.0
120.137.31.46
121.48.86.101
124.108.8.193
203.176.168.138
121.8.78.80
203.208.16.33
117.59.108.246
60.247.234.113
221.199.128.2
58.30.243.128
210.14.112.246
202.141.160.85
202.122.52.102
123.180.47.171
120.24.125.242
116.193.16.10
202.192.240.146
123.180.246.184
168.160.74.203
122.112.132.26
211.136.122.102
116.116.45.106